Counter plc ladder diagram software

The brief pulse would not normally be wanted, and would be designed out of a system either by extending the length of the pulse, or decreas. Otherwise, the ladder diagram is nothing more than black symbols on a white background. A plc counter is a function block that counts up or down until it reaches a limit. Controlling water level in the plc ladder logic program duration. Download plc ladder logic program software for free. Dia diagram editor is a free open source ladder diagram software for windows. Plc timers and counters, their types and practical uses in this article, i am only going to talk about the plc timers and counters, this article can be a bit longer as i will be sharing with you the ladder logic diagrams, which will explain the practical uses of plc timers and counters. Many plc ladder logic program examples are available for download, and you will have to install the plc programming software to view the example ladder. Typically a highspeed counter is a hardware device. In this video i will talk about the different types of plc counters you can use. The constructor software has the tools you need to create fast, professional electrical diagrams. I am pretty sure you know the importance of timers and.

This class explains how ladder diagram programming is used to program timers and counters. Jun 28, 2015 the ladder diagram graphical programming language is standardized by the plcopen organization, and thereby the symbols used in ladder diagrams. Gx developer plc software mitsubishi plc programming youtube. For this program, the relay logics ladder diagram is duplicated with ladder logic. Plc timers and counters, their types and practical uses.

Plc fiddle online editor and simulator in your browser. However, if you take your time and learn how to convert a basic wiring diagram to a ladder logic plc program, it can be an easily achievable task. The system uses both proximity sensors and limit switches. Feb 09, 2015 ladder logic was designed to have the same look and feel as electrical ladder diagrams, but with ladder logic, the physical contacts and coils are replaced with memory bits.

The counter which increment value is known as up counters and down counters decrement the integer values on a trigger. Ladder logic examples and plc programming examples lekule. An example of this could be to keep track of how many times a process has been completed. Education software downloads ladder logic simulator by triangle research international, inc and many more programs are available for instant and free download. Jun 27, 2015 one other thing that causes good plc ladder logic examples to be so hard to find, is that ladder logic often is brand specific. Counter and timer instructions are internal features of a program that provide increased functionality and precision for a plc application.

Entertron reintroduces the concept of free plc programming software. I am trying to program a plc programmable logic controller, model. Plc programming intermediate instructions ctu count up. Nov 07, 2016 ladder logic programming timer and counter melsec tutorial. Realization of timers, counters and shift registers for programmable controller using ladder diagram. The thing is that counting is in fact widely used in plc programming. Describe the use of timers and counters in ladder logic describesuchtermsasdescribe such terms as retentive, cascade, delayondelay on and delay off elith ti fexplain the operation of tonton, toftof, andd rtorto titimers explain the use of ctu and ctd timers utilize timers and counters in ladder logic. Ladder language allows to realize programs on plc in an electric way. Since ladder logic is a graphical programming language, the plc programs written in ladder logic are a combination of ladder logic symbols.

And i want to focus on only these most important ladder logic instructions in this. Software for electrical wiring diagram all about circuits. Some of these software can be used for industrial purposes, while some can be used for both educational and industrial purposes. Counters for extended plc program of ladder diagram 05312016 11282018 arcozhang as long as you provide a clock signal as a counter counting input signal, counter can achieve timing function, clock signal multiplied by the cycle counter value is time. Another reason to make use of ladder logic examples is, that you can learn from them.

Chapter 7 timers, counters and tc applications introduction timers and counters are discussed in the same chapter since most rules apply to both. Can you please tell me a good and an easy program to design circuit diagrams for a project. I need to use a high speed counter, c235, using x0 pulses but could not find a clear explanation in the delta manual or their software program, wplsoft ver 2. Lets say you have a specific functionality, you want to implement in your ladder logic, a plc timer function for example. Using counter in plc ladder logic i have used automation studio 6. Each device in the relay rack would be represented by a symbol on the ladder diagram with connections between those devices shown. Apr 22, 2018 a counter is a plc instruction that either increments counts up or. Using this software, you can easily create a ladder diagram. Ladder logic programming timer and counter melsec tutorial.

When the res instruction is enabled, it resets the timer on delay, retentive timer, and counter up, counter down instruction having the same address as the res instruction. Displays the input steps, their timer, counter mode, relay, and output data. A counter is a plc instruction that either increments counts up or. Counters in plc ladder diaghram plc programmable logic. This video shows how to use the counter up in plc ladder programming language.

Plc counter instructions counters in plc programming ladder. In other words they dont physically exist in the plc but rather they are simulated in software. But it is suitable to use in a ladder logic program and inout variables. Colorhighlighting of ladder diagram components only works, of course, when the computer running the program editing software is connected to the plc and the plc is in the run mode and the show status feature of the editing software is enabled. Plc counters and timers provides an overview of the functions of counter and timer instructions in a plc ladder logic program. A preferable alternative is to use a pc with an appropriate software package available from the plc manufacturer to develop and display the ladder diagram on the pc monitor. Ladder diagram, better known as ladder logic, is a programming language used to program plcs programmable logic controllers. Gx developer plc software mitsubishi plc programming. Learn vocabulary, terms, and more with flashcards, games, and other study tools. Once completed, the resulting file is transmitted from the pc to the plc for execution. To study the working of up counter plc program in allen bradley programmable logic controller plc. As a company, entertron was first to offer free plc programming software way back in 1984. Full circuit simulation adds to the power of the constructor by giving you a unique troubleshooting ability that can help you narrow down problems early on before you hard wire in the field.

Nov 27, 2017 acc automation automation training videos free best plc simulator free free plc simulator plc fiddle online editor and simulator in your browser plc ladder logic examples plc ladder logic simulator plc logic programming plc programming ladder logic plc programming solved examples plc scan cycle plc school projects plcfiddle programmable. Both the up and down counter starts counting on one trigger. Education software downloads ladder logic simulator by triangle research international, inc and many more programs are. The first thing you naturally would do, is to think about it for yourself. Timers were constructed in the past as an addon device to relays. Counters are plc instructions that either increment or decrement or decrement the integer value when the input line make true from false. Counters for extended plc program of ladder diagram. Timers and counters have been in existence for as long as relays and provide an important component in the development of logic. Realization of timers, counters and shift registers for. This is a simple program that waits one second and then increments a counter variable and repeats.

Aug 14, 2018 the ctu leverages a specific data structure, called the counter, present in most plc systems. Ladder diagram timers and counters for siemens plcs 300. It starts when the plc application starts and increments a counter variable every second. The most common language used to program plcs is ladder diagram ld, also known as relay ladder logic rll this is a graphical language showing the logical relationships between inputs and outputs as though they were contacts and coils in a hardwired electromechanical relay circuit.

Hardware counters do exist in the plc and they are not dependent on scan time. It examines the basic rules for each type of timer and counter used in lad programming for s71200 plcs. Not just the ladder diagram, but a lot of different types of diagrams such as erd, network diagram, use case diagram, uml diagrams, etc. Use is made of the pc drives and printer as required. Zeliosoft is a free zeliologic smart relay programmer software for windows. There are really only a few that you will use again and again as a plc programmer. Ladder logic was originally a written method to document the design and construction of relay racks as used in manufacturing and process control. With all that said timers are very useful and it is crucial for every plc programmer to know the basics of counting in a plc program. Status indication is shown in this ladder diagram program, with the counter s preset value pv of 25 and the counter s current value cv of 0 shown highlighted in blue. Mar 18, 2019 upgrading a machine to plc control may seem like a daunting task. Counterplc ladder logic program for an elecrtopneumatic circuit. Download plc ladder logic program software for free windows. Assists users, students and teachers alike when they want to learn about plc programming.

Counter the highlevel instruction specification of all the inner structurespre integer specifying up to which value the timer will countacc integer specifying the current time value of the timer. Resets the accumulated value and status bit of a timer or counter. Up counter plc program example of counter ladder logics. Ladder logic simulator free download windows version. How to convert a basic wiring diagram to a plc program realpars. These free software help you learn the basics of plc programming. The paper describes the architecture timers, counters, drum counters and shift of s. You can read more about the different types of counters here. Although there are at least a hundred ladder logic instructions in rockwells programming software packages rslogix 55005000, most are rarely used. The normal counters listed above are typically software counters. Constructor software 15 draw electrical or ladder diagrams. It can be used as a ladder diagram software because it uses the ladder diagram and fbd language to program the smart relay.

Plc counter instructions ladder logic, programmable logic. I usually deal with plc, relays, motors, tblocks, power supplies so i need to design the circuit and the electrical box so that the worker can assembly it. You can learn ladder logic language, sequential text language, etc. Ladder diagram ld programming basics of programmable. In it, you can create the whole ladder diagram from the scratch or you can edit various inbuilt examples of the ladder diagram. Status indication is shown in this ladder diagram program, with the counters preset value. One other thing that causes good plc ladder logic examples to be so hard to find, is that ladder logic often is brand specific. And there is an updown counter which does both the up and down counting.

1137 669 430 404 1019 265 1388 562 535 1173 1234 873 1453 1011 1524 225 32 654 1230 454 1061 1424 1278 793 349 658 1117 1192 219 20 976 1166 630 98 918 805 999 1139 192 248 755 1076 462 680 1315 445 1172 382 1083